K000153054: Glib vulnerability CVE-2025-4373
Security Advisory Description A flaw was found in GLib, which is vulnerable to an integer overflow in the gstringinsertunichar function. [SECURITY] Fedora 42 Update: glib2-2.84.4-1.fc42
GLib is the low-level core library that forms the basis for projects such as GTK+ and GNOME. It provides data structure handling for C, portability wrappers, and interfaces for such runtime functionality as an event loop, threads, dynamic loading, and an object system...
